Beschrijving

Stavros talks passionately about educationalists being trauma informed. He completed a law degree before moving into teaching, and now is able to share his thoughts on the importance of being human in the classroom. He shares his thoughts on helping children thrive, focusing on ‘stage, not age’, ‘Psychological safety’, and understanding trauma and showing empathy to all. Heads, Shoulders, Tea and Toast is a podcast that talks about the good, the bad, and the ugly of education. We talk to educationalists, who tell their stories with the aim of hearing from the ‘cliff face’- in an ever changing world, education needs to change to keep up with the times…but when?
